Balıklıgölü Kanalı
Balıklıgölü Kanalı is a canal in Hatay, Mediterranean Turkey. Balıklıgölü Kanalı is situated nearby to the village Aktaş, as well as near Kumtepe.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Lake Amik
Locality
Lake Amik or the Lake of Antioch was a large freshwater lake in the basin of the Orontes River in Hatay Province, Turkey. It was located north-east of the ancient city of Antioch. The lake was drained between the 1940s–1970s. Lake Amik is situated 4 km west of Balıklıgölü Kanalı.
Amik Valley
Locality

The Amik Valley is a plain in Hatay Province, southern Turkey. It is close to the city of Antakya. Along with Dabiq in northwestern Syria, it is believed to be one of two possible sites of the battle of Armageddon according to Islamic eschatology. Amik Valley is situated 4 km south of Balıklıgölü Kanalı.
